The United States (US) Visitor Management System Market was estimated at USD 203 Million in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 239 Million by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 2.6% from 2026 to 2032.
In the United States, visitor management systems are gaining traction across sectors such as healthcare, education, and corporate environments. The rising demand for enhanced security measures and efficient visitor tracking solutions is driving the market forward.
As organizations increasingly prioritize safety, the market is witnessing the integration of advanced technologies like biometric authentication and cloud-based solutions. This technological shift is enhancing the overall visitor experience while ensuring compliance with stringent regulatory requirements.

Despite its growth, the United States Visitor Management System market faces several restraints. Data privacy concerns loom large, especially with the increasing scrutiny of how personal information is collected and managed. Compliance with regulations such as GDPR and CCPA adds layers of complexity for organizations seeking to implement visitor management solutions.
on top of that, integrating these systems with existing security infrastructure can be a daunting task, often requiring significant time and resources. The need for user-friendly interfaces further complicates the situation as companies strive to balance security measures with a seamless visitor experience.
The market is observing a notable trend towards the adoption of advanced features such as facial recognition and mobile-based check-ins. These innovations cater to the growing demand for contactless solutions, especially in light of the COVID-19 pandemic.
on top of that, organizations are increasingly focusing on data analytics to enhance decision-making and personalize visitor experiences. This trend is steering investments towards technologies that enable real-time reporting and monitoring, which are essential for maintaining security standards.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
